During the Second Imperial Civil War, Telan Medon, a Pau'an residing on the planet of Utapau, fulfilled the role of Port Administrator in Pau City. Pau City was a sizable city located within a sinkhole that descended far into the planet's depths. The conflict saw Darth Krayt's Galactic Empire, a Sith-dominated organization governing much of the galaxy, clash with various rebel groups, including the Galactic Alliance Remnant. Displaying sympathy for the Remnant, Medon consistently offered its fleet a haven, protecting them from Krayt's Empire for eight years commencing in 130 ABY.
Following the poisoning of the oceans on Dac by the Sith scientist Vul Isen in 138 ABY, the Remnant fleet orchestrated a large-scale evacuation of the water world, incurring significant losses in a subsequent engagement with Krayt's forces. In the aftermath of this battle, Medon welcomed the fleet to Pau City, personally greeting its commander, Admiral Gar Stazi, upon his arrival. As the wounded disembarked from the ships, Stazi assured Medon of their swift departure.
Unbeknownst to them, a mouse droid belonging to Muerdo, an Utai spy working for the Hutt crime lord Vedo Anjiliac Atirue, recorded their conversation. Vedo then relayed this information to the Sith, aiming to ensnare Isen. Having also poisoned the Hutt moon of Da Soocha, Vedo, seeking vengeance, employed Cade Skywalker, a former Jedi who was actively hunting Sith, to travel to Utapau and eliminate Isen, suspecting he would target the Pau'ans for sheltering Krayt's enemies. Vedo's scheme succeeded, and Skywalker killed Isen on Utapau, averting a poisonous fate for the planet just in time.
During their conflict with Darth Krayt's Empire, Telan Medon sympathized with the Galactic Alliance Remnant, consistently providing their fleet with a safe haven from Krayt's forces for eight years. Given the Pau'ans' historical support for the Galactic Republic, a past government, Medon viewed aiding the Alliance as upholding tradition. Furthermore, the Port Administrator regarded Krayt's Sith as malevolent and dedicated himself to opposing their wickedness, particularly condemning the genocide on Dac and refusing to condone it as the Port Administrator of Pau City.
Medon maintained a friendly relationship with Alliance Admiral Gar Stazi, who felt comfortable addressing him by his first name. Medon had yellow teeth, black and blue eyes, and light gray skin patterned with dark gray pinstripes.
Medon was seen wearing red clothing, including a cape and a high collar.
Telan Medon made an appearance in the forty-ninth issue of the Star Wars: Legacy comic series. Penned by John Ostrander and illustrated by Jan Duursema, the issue was published by Dark Horse Comics on June 30, 2010. Despite sharing a surname with Tion Medon, a Pau City Port Administrator from the Clone Wars era featured in the 2005 film Star Wars: Episode III Revenge of the Sith, no confirmed connection exists between the two characters.
